...

Text file src/cuelang.org/go/doc/tutorial/kubernetes/original/services/mon/alertmanager/configmap.yaml

Documentation: cuelang.org/go/doc/tutorial/kubernetes/original/services/mon/alertmanager

     1apiVersion: v1
     2kind: ConfigMap
     3metadata:
     4  name: alertmanager
     5data:
     6  alerts.yaml: |-
     7    receivers:
     8      - name: 'pager'
     9          # email_configs:
    10          # - to: 'team-X+alerts-critical@example.org'
    11        slack_configs:
    12        - channel: '#cloudmon'
    13          text: "{{ range .Alerts }}{{ .Annotations.description }}\n{{ end }}"
    14          send_resolved: True
    15
    16    # The root route on which each incoming alert enters.
    17    route:
    18      receiver: pager
    19
    20      # The labels by which incoming alerts are grouped together. For example,
    21      # multiple alerts coming in for cluster=A and alertname=LatencyHigh would
    22      # be batched into a single group.
    23      group_by: ['alertname', 'cluster' ]

View as plain text